Shared Imaginal Practice is done in small groups of 3 and is a non-hierarchical relational practice. In it you are exploring the imaginal realm together and opening the door to being deeply in touch with the full force of the subconscious realm.
It has been described as being akin to dreaming while you are awake - it brings awareness and presence to an often new or unexplored part of people’s experience and creates space for more radical acceptance and relaxation into the truth and depth of the present moment.

Rosa Lewis is a mystic and meditation teacher. Her teaching combines Buddhist emptiness, shadow work, tantric embodiment, the archetypal realm, mysticism and a radically new way of relating to heartfulness.
She enjoys creating practices that simultaneously guide people towards more clarity and precision of experience while also softening into the presence of the moment.
Her approach to spirituality involves healing the trauma or embracing the darkness that exists in all of us while also helping people uncover and nourish whatever it is that most wants to come alive in their beings, in order to create more joyful presence in the world.
